Buying A Used PDA - Is That A Smart Move?

Tip! You need accessories. These are the basic, non essential goodies that are accompanying your PDA, like a nice leather case, a spare battery, a data/recharge cable, a recharge cradle and the like.

Around 30 million PDA's were manufactured and sold world wide by the end of 2004. This huge number guarantees a large secondary market for PDA's, and a lot of bargains could be found among them. So if you're considering buying A PDA that was previously owned and used by someone else, you do have a lot to choose from.

Previously used PDA's can be divided into 2 groups : used PDA's and rectified PDA's. The used PDA's have been used by another party and are sold as-is. They may work properly, and they may not. The rectified PDA is usually sold by the manufacturer, and has some kind of guaranteed-to-work warranty. Rectified PDA's are all the PDA's a manufacturer or a supplier can't sell as new ones, for various reasons.

In this article we'll discuss the used PDA option and leave the rectified PDA option for another time. Buying a used PDA can be a good solution for anyone who wants to enjoy a PDA but doesn't want to shell out the full price of a new PDA.

Finding a used PDA online is easy. All you need to do is go to a site like ebay.com and look for PDA's. Before you go choosing your PDA at ebay, remember to do a few things:

1. Understand that the items on ebay may not be presented as they really are. You don't see the PDA with your own eyes. Remember to accept this fact, and the possibility for surprises when you get your PDA.

2. Do your won research and make up your mind as to the PDA model you want to get. DO this research before you go shopping, so you'll have a good background about which model you want, and what are the potential problems it has. You can also ask the owner if his PDA suffers from these problems.

After you do your homework, go to ebay and start looking around. If you're interested in a popular model, you will probably find dozens of sellers.

While you're on ebay, try to buy form a seller who has more than 50 feedbacks Bad sellers change their ebay ID to get rid if the negative feedbacks they got, so they will have only few feedbacks.

The pro's of buying a used PDA on ebay:

? Some great values available - especially if you look around long enough.

? Amazing amount of choices - dozens of sellers.

? Extra software and accessories may be included - ask them if it does.

? You Might be able to negotiate an even better price

The con's of buying a used PDA on ebay:

? Product may not be what was advertised

? Risk of product being "Dead on Arrival"

? Usually no warranty available

? Risk of not receiving PDA

? Possibly no support after sale

The advantages of buying a PDA on ebay are obvious, but the risks are notable, too. Before buying a used PDA, make sure you look at the option of buying a rectified PDA. IT will almost always cost more, but there is a chance of getting a better PDA for your money, as well as a warranty.
